- 1、本文档共23页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
C程序设计课后习题谜底4 6章
《C程序设计》课后习题答案(4-6章)
第四章
8、
#define PI 3.1415926
#includestdio.h
void main()
{
float h,r,l,s,sq,vq,vz;
printf(please input r,h:);
scanf(%f,%f,r,h);
l=2*PI*r;
s=r*r*PI;
sq=4*PI*r*r;
vq=4.0/3.0*PI*r*r*r;
vz=PI*r*r*h;
printf(l=%6.2f\n,l);
printf(s=%6.2f\n,s);
printf(sq=%6.2f\n,sq);
printf(vq=%6.2f\n,vq);
printf(vz=%6.2f\n,vz);
}
9、
#includestdio.h
void main()
{
float c,f;
printf(please input f:);
scanf(%f,f);
c=(5.0/9.0)*(f-32);
printf(c:%6.2f\n,c);
}
第五章
5、
#includestdio.h
void main()
{
int x,y;
printf(please input x:);
scanf(%d,x);
if(x1)
{y=x;
printf(x=%d,y=x=%d\n,x,y);}
else if(x10)
{y=2*x-1;
printf(x=%d,y=2*x-1=%d\n,x,y);}
else
{y=3*x-11;
printf(x=%d,y=3*x-11=%d\n,x,y);}
}
6、
#includestdio.h
void main()
{
float score;
char grade;
printf(please input the student score:);
scanf(%f,score);
while((score100)||(score0))
{printf(error,please input again!\n);
printf(please input the student score:);
scanf(%f,score);
}
switch((int)(score/10))
{
case 10:
case 9:grade=A;break;
case 8:grade=B;break;
case 7:grade=C;break;
case 6:grade=D;break;
case 5:
case 4:
case 3:
case 2:
case 1:
case 0:grade=E;
}
printf(score is %f,grade is %c\n,score,grade);
}
7、
#includestdio.h
#includemath.h
void main()
{
long int num;
int indiv,ten,hundred,thousand,ten_thousand,place;
printf(please input an integer(0-99999):);
scanf(%ld,num);
if(num9999) place=5;
else if(num999) place=4;
else if(num99) place=3;
else if(num9) place=2;
else place=1;
printf(Total digits:%d\n,place);
printf(For each number:);
ten_thousand=num/10000;
thousand=(int)(num-ten_thousand*10000)/1000;
hundred=(int)(num-ten_thousand*10000-thousand*1000)/100;
ten=(int)(num-ten_thousand*10000-thousand*1000-hundred*100)/10;
indiv=(int)(num-ten_thousand*10000-thousand*1000-hundred*100-ten*10);
if(ten_thousand!=0) printf(%d,%d,%d,%d,%d,ten_thousand,thousand,hundred,ten,indiv);
else if(thousand!=0) printf(%d,%d,%d,%d,thousand,hundred,ten,indiv);
else if(hundred!=0) p
您可能关注的文档
- Cimjeqs手艺经济与企业管理期末复习题要点.doc
- CISA认证完整手册.doc
- Cisco路由器交换机配置敕令详解.doc
- CISPCISM测验及注册申请表模板.doc
- CIS筹划全程第四部分.doc
- CISP知识系统大纲20正式版.doc
- cj 某某质量管理工程咨询有限公司5S举动培训教材.doc
- CK6163型数控车床设计开题告诉.doc
- ck6140数控车床毕业设计开题告诉.doc
- Ckutnbe教师考试新课程实际试题及答案.doc
- PDM软件:Siemens Teamcenter二次开发_(17).Teamcenter最佳实践与案例分析.docx
- SCADA软件:GE Proficy二次开发_(4).Proficy开发环境搭建.docx
- 智能电表软件:Landis+Gyr智能电表二次开发_(13).系统集成与测试.docx
- 智能电表软件:Elster智能电表二次开发_(8).Elster智能电表二次开发环境搭建.docx
- PDM软件:Siemens Teamcenter二次开发_(11).TeamcenterAPI与编程基础.docx
- SCADA软件:GE Proficy二次开发_(7).报警与事件管理.docx
- 智能电表软件:Echelon智能电表二次开发_(11).智能电表行业标准与法规.docx
- 智能电表软件:Itron智能电表二次开发_(6).用户界面定制与开发.docx
- 智能电表软件:Elster智能电表二次开发_(9).Elster智能电表二次开发工具使用.docx
- PDM软件:PTC Windchill二次开发_(21).Windchill最佳实践案例分析.docx
文档评论(0)